Swedbank AB Has $7.58 Billion Position in NVIDIA Corporation $NVDA

Swedbank AB raised its stake in shares of NVIDIA Corporation (NASDAQ:NVDAFree Report) by 1.8%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 43,437,688 shares of the computer hardware maker’s stock after purchasing an additional 771,913 shares during the quarter. NVIDIA accounts for about 8.0% of Swedbank AB’s holdings, making the stock its biggest holding. Swedbank AB’s holdings in NVIDIA were worth $7,575,533,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DAG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, May 20th. The computer hardware maker reported $1.87 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.76 by $0.11. NVIDIA had a return on equity of 96.94% and a net margin of 62.97%.The business had revenue of $81.61 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$78.42 billion.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.81 earnings per share. The business’s revenue was up 85.2%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that NVIDIA Corporation will post 8.8 EPS for the current year.

About NVIDIA

NVIDIA Corporation, founded in 1993 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California, is a global technology company that designs and develops graphics processing units (GPUs) and system-on-chip (SoC) technologies. Co-founded by Jensen Huang, who serves as president and chief executive officer, along with Chris Malachowsky and Curtis Priem, NVIDIA has grown from a graphics-focused chipmaker into a broad provider of accelerated computing hardware and software for multiple industries.

The company’s product portfolio spans discrete GPUs for gaming and professional visualization (marketed under the GeForce and NVIDIA RTX lines), high-performance data center accelerators used for AI training and inference (including widely adopted platforms such as the A100 and H100 series), and Tegra SoCs for automotive and edge applications.
